A serious carp fishing session can sometimes mean compromising on a good night’s sleep, but not anymore. We have introduced two new Sleep Systems to our Inspire range that will offer you such a comfortable place to snooze that you may never want to go back to your real bed again.
The Sleep Systems are based on the Inspire eight-leg Daddy Long and six-leg Relax bedchairs respectively, both of which offer fold-flat profiled frames with double fold space-saving hinges, and lumbar support mattresses made with the best high-density foam. In short, these bedchairs offer a more comfortable night’s sleep in a bivvy than you thought possible.
Whichever bedchair you choose, in these Sleep Systems they are paired with our new five-season sleeping bags, securely attached by a full-length, 360-degree zipper, which starts at the head section to allow the angler to position their pillow perfectly. The sleeping bags are made using extremely durable, soft-touch peach skin outer fabric shells that enclose generous layers of memory-treated, deep-filled hollow fibre, ensuring unrivalled levels of insulation. This inner fibre also helps the sleeping bags retain their shape to further boost heat retention efficiency. The internal shell is fitted to the shape of the bag, eliminating tangles and restriction for those anglers who prefer to sleep clothed, while micro fleece on the head and chin sections offers further comfort and helps keep your pillow in place. The sleeping bags are finished with heavy-duty crash zips with high-vis pullers, anti-jam beading as well as generously padded, oversized anti-draft baffles and zip-lock secures to prevent zippers opening unnecessarily.
These amazing systems have been specifically designed to offer the highest levels of luxury and comfort in carp fishing. The only thing that will interrupt your slumber is the sound of a bite alarm when you hook a monster.
